scrapymon

Simple management UI for scrapyd. The demo is available at http://scrapymon.demo.jxltom.me/ with admin for both username and password. Note that the demo will reset every 40 minutes and it may take some time to spin up if no one has accessed it for a while.

Features

  • Show all projects from a Scrapyd server
  • Show all versions of each project
  • Show all spiders in each project
  • Show all pending, running and finished jobs from a Scrapyd server
  • Show logs of each job
  • Schedule spiders run
  • Cancel pending or running jobs
  • Delete project or a specific version
  • Http basic access authentication supported
  • Served by Gevent for production use

Getting Started

  • Install by pip install scrapymon.

  • Run by scrapymon [--host=<host>] [--port=<port>] [--server=<address_with_port>] [--auth=<username:password>].

    • Default --host is 0.0.0.0
    • Default --port is 5000
    • Default --server is http://127.0.0.1:6800
    • Default --auth is admin:admin
  • Or you can run by scrapymon with valid environment variables $HOST, $PORT, $SCRAPYD_SERVER and $BASIC_AUTH.
